**Who to Contact: Image Slimming (Project Thimbleweed)**

So your container won't fit under the size budget again. First, check whether the base image switched back to the fat variant — happens more often than you'd think. The slimming pipeline is owned by the Build Ergonomics squad, and they're pretty responsive during business hours. For genuinely broken builds at 3 a.m., page them; otherwise just drop a message to their shared inbox.

pager mailbox: quenael@zemvarsys.internal

Team — the Lanternbay read-replica lag alarm fired twice during canary, both times under 40 seconds and self-recovered. I've adjusted the threshold from 30s to 60s with a two-sample confirmation window to cut noise. Please review the alerting diff in the Mirewood repo before we promote. For reference, the canary run carried the following trace token.

build token for kajeg-bageg: htk6_abeb3e

## Artifact signing — Farequest pricing experiment

For the weekly sync: the Farequest ticket-pricing experiment ships as a standalone bundle so it can be toggled without a full Gatewise release. All experiment artifacts are signed at build time, and the rollout job refuses unsigned bundles. Cohort assignment logic lives inside the bundle, so tampering checks matter here. Verify every Farequest artifact against the key below.

release key, fajef-kajeg: bky19_LdLu6Ne6FLi8he2c24d